Pressure Relief Valve Maintenance
The following general procedure is recommended for the disassembling of a 9100 Series PRV
Non-standard or “special” configurations are possible and these instructions may not be reflective of them
A special configuration is indicated by a special code at the end of the PRV’s part number
See section 17
Always make sure there is no pressure in the system prior to removing a PRV
The 9100 Series contains several different orifice sizes
For most C to G orifices, the valves are bottom entry type with the bonnet integral to the body cavity
These valves have a removable inlet base
Larger orifice sized valves are top entry types and have removable bonnets
